The Blue School is a secondary school in Wells for ages 11 to 18. It is one of the 301 schools in Somerset. It ranks 5th of 27 secondary schools in Somerset. Its latest Ofsted rating is Good, from an inspection in October 2017.

What Ofsted said
From the inspection on 17 May 2023
The Blue School's values of respect, empathy and politeness are understood by the whole school community. Pupils at the school benefit from warm and respectful relationships with their teachers. Teachers care deeply about pupils' academic progress and their well- being. Pupils appreciate the personal advice and guidance they receive about their learning and their futures. This means that pupils are happy and safe and they achieve well. Pupils are proud to be part of the school's community. The school is inclusive. Many take part in the wide variety of clubs and activities on offer. There are many opportunities for pupil leadership in all year groups. Sixth-form students are good role models and enjoy supporting younger pupils. Bullying is not tolerated. Pupils have confidence that staff will resolve issues when they arise. Leaders have ensured that the curriculum is broad and academically rigorous. This does not compromise a significant focus on creative and practical subjects. Pupils enjoy learning. Pupils learn about the wider world. They are well supported when it comes to making choices about their next steps.
What the school should improve
- Checks on what pupils have learned do not always identify gaps in pupils' knowledge, particularly in key stage 3. This hinders teachers' ability to address pupils' misconceptions or pick up on any missed learning. Leaders should support teachers to use appropriate assessment strategies to enable pupils to achieve well across the curriculum.
